So what are some good healthy resolutions for 2021?

Lose Weight

Losing weight is one of the most popular new years resolutions that people choose. It’s no surprise after an indulgent Christmas that people feel that they need to lose a few pounds or overhaul their diet altogether. Losing weight has so many benefits and if you do decide to do it this year then you will not only look and feel better but it could save your life. But the real goal should be getting healthier and make smarter food choices and exercise, rather than losing weight for the sake of losing weight.

De-cluttering

Minimalism and decluttering can help to reduce stress and anxiety. It can also help you to sleep better and boost productivity and creativity because you can concentrate better when you have a clear space. Decluttering your home doesn’t mean that you have to get rid of everything though, it just means that you need to add a little more organization to your home and your life. For example, if you don’t have space in your home for certain things then you could use a secure storage facility to keep things like bikes, outdoor toys you won’t need until the summer, or valuables that might even be safer there than at home. Have a good sort out at the beginning of the year and start 2021 as you mean to go on.

Stop Smoking

Smoking is bad for you and there are no two ways about it. In 2021 everyone knows that smoking is not good for your health, it increases your risk of getting cancer and can also affect other things such as your heart and lungs. Giving up smoking is one of the best things you can do for yourself this year. If you do, you’ll notice you can breathe easier, run faster and your skin will be better too.
